Higher build costs hit Taylor Wimpey’s bottom line

Taylor Wimpey

Margins fall to 18% at country’s second biggest housebuilder

Margins at Taylor Wimpey were hit in the first six months of the year by the increased cost of building homes, the firm said today.

Operating margins were down to 18% from 20% for the same period last year. Full year operating margins in 2018 were 22%.
